Sinbad & The Monkeys (Original)
Artist: Nadir Quinto
Medium: Watercolour on Board
Size: 12" x 8" (310mm x 210mm)
Date: 1980
Code: QuintoStoned
This is the unique original Watercolour painting by Nadir Quinto.
Sinbad and his crew stone some monkeys who retaliate with stoned fruit. Who writes this stuff? From a children's adaptation of The Seven Voyages of Sinbad with good interspecies symbiosis depicted by Nadir Quinto.
- Artist Biography
Nadir Quinto (1918 - 1994; Milan, Italy)
Nadir Quinto's contributions to the Thriller Picture Library were strips featuring the adventures of Robin Hood. Nadir Quinto was born in Milan and attended the Accademia di Brera and, immediately after the War, began contributing picture strips to most of the top Italian comic journals such as Dinamite, Albi di Salgari, Festival and L'Intrepido. In 1946 he began drawing and lettering strips for Corrieri dei Piccoli. After his brief time drawing Robin Hood strips for the TPL, he left comics to concentrate on illustration, only to return to drawing strips for the Italian comic journals in the 1970s.
